The 2022 KDM Hire Cookstown 100 will take place on Friday and Saturday 22/23 April. This year will be somewhat special, as the organizing club is celebrating their 100th birthday! From its small beginnings in 1922, the Cookstown & District Motor Cycle Club hold the honour of being the oldest road race on the island
